]> git.pld-linux.org Git - packages/java-xalan.git/blame - java-xalan.spec
- removed all Group fields translations (oure rpm now can handle translating
[packages/java-xalan.git] / java-xalan.spec
CommitLineData
40842614 1
2%define major 2
3%define minor 2
4%define micro 0
5%define ver %{major}_%{minor}
6
7Summary: XSLT processor for Java
8Summary(pl): Procesor XSLT napisany w Javie
9Name: xalan-j
10Version: %{major}.%{minor}
2bba51c6 11Release: 3
40842614 12License: Apache Software License
13Group: Applications/Publishing/XML/Java
40842614 14URL: http://xml.apache.org/xalan-j
15Source0: http://xml.apache.org/xalan-j/dist/%{name}_%{ver}-src.tar.gz
16Patch0: xalan-build.patch
17BuildRequires: jdk
a8576464 18BuildRequires: xerces-j >= 1.4.4-2
40842614 19Requires: jre
a8576464 20Requires: xerces-j >= 1.4.4-2
40842614 21BuildArch: noarch
22BuildRoot: %{tmpdir}/%{name}-%{version}-root-%(id -u -n)
23
a8576464 24%define _javaclassdir %{_libdir}/java/
40842614 25
26%description
27XSLT processor for Java.
28
29%description -l pl
30Procesor XSLT napisany w Javie.
31
32%prep
33%setup -q -n xalan-j_%{major}_%{minor}_%{micro}
34%patch0 -p1
35
40842614 36mv build.sh build.sh.dos
37sed 's/
38$//' < build.sh.dos > build.sh
a8576464 39
40%build
41JAVA_HOME=%{_libdir}/java-sdk
42export JAVA_HOME
43
44ANT_OPTS=-O
45export ANT_OPTS
2bba51c6 46
40842614 47sh build.sh docs
48
49%install
50rm -rf $RPM_BUILD_ROOT
51install -d $RPM_BUILD_ROOT%{_javaclassdir}
52
2bba51c6 53install bin/xml-apis.jar $RPM_BUILD_ROOT%{_javaclassdir}
40842614 54install build/xalan.jar $RPM_BUILD_ROOT%{_javaclassdir}
55
56gzip -9nf readme.html License
57
58%clean
59rm -rf $RPM_BUILD_ROOT
60
61%files
62%defattr(644,root,root,755)
63%doc {readme.html,License}.gz build/docs/*
2bba51c6 64%{_javaclassdir}/*.jar
This page took 0.061016 seconds and 4 git commands to generate.